Senators casting votes on the CLARITY Act in a legislative session

The Senate is set to vote today, May 14, on the CLARITY Act, a critical bill that aims to clarify regulatory oversight of crypto assets, determining whether they fall under the SEC or CFTC. This decision could have major ramifications for the market, sparking speculation about potential price movements.

Whatโ€™s at Stake?

The proposed legislation features significant potential for the crypto industry, which has long sought clearer regulations. "Regulatory clarity removes a systematic risk premium," noted one commentator, illustrating the broad sentiment in the market. However, the immediate reaction to such clarity remains mixed.

Immediate Market Reaction?

Analysts express skepticism regarding short-term upticks following the vote. For example, a commenter stated, "Clarity usually kills the narrative pump," suggesting established rules may shift focus from speculation to actual adoption and utility of crypto.

Some believe price fluctuations around the vote could lead to quick exits for traders. Factors to consider include:

  • If the price jumps 5-8% after the news

  • If the overall market trend remains negative

  • If trading volume indicates selling pressure rather than accumulation

Institutional Interest

Interestingly, "This also opens the doors for pension funds and insurance companies," which reflects the positive long-term outlook among investors. These large entities could enter the market once regulations are clarified, possibly stabilizing it in the long run. However, itโ€™s crucial to note that they may not invest immediately.

Future Market Outlook

Thereโ€™s a strong chance that the Senate will approve the CLARITY Act, leading to a significant shift in crypto regulation. Experts estimate around a 70% likelihood of this outcome as ongoing discussions show bipartisan support for clearer guidelines. If passed, we could see institutional players slowly entering, which might stabilize the market long-term. In contrast, a failure to pass the bill could exacerbate uncertainty, potentially leading prices to dip in the short run, with estimates suggesting a possible fall of 5-10% among speculative traders. Overall, the forthcoming weeks will likely see mixed reactions as investors gauge the long-term implications versus immediate market sentiment.
